To effectively search for product codes, start by entering relevant keywords related to your equipment in the FDA product code database's search bar. Once you locate the product code, pay close attention to its description, classification, and associated regulations. Understanding the classification—Class I, II, or III—is essential, as it dictates the compliance route your equipment must follow.

To ensure adherence to regulatory requirements, begin by thoroughly examining your equipment's classification and referencing the FDA product code database. Familiarize yourself with the specific regulations pertinent to your equipment category, including:
For example, Class III products necessitate a Premarket Approval (PMA) application, which represents the most stringent type of marketing application mandated by the FDA. The FDA's review of a PMA application typically spans 274 days, making it essential to plan accordingly.

What are the classifications of medical instruments according to the FDA?
In 2020, 35% of controlled medical instruments were classified as Class I (minimal oversight), 53% as Class II (stricter supervision), and 9% as Class III (highest risk with rigorous regulatory standards).

How can users access the FDA product code database?
Users can access the FDA product code database by visiting the FDA's official website, navigating to the 'Medical Devices' section, and selecting 'Product Code Classification Database.'
What search criteria can be used in the FDA product code database?
Users can search for product codes using various criteria, including equipment name, classification regulation, and the product code itself.
